Abstract:
The present experiment was carried out on mice.The changes in contentsof 12 essential trace elements in the brain of mice were measured by inductivelycoupled plasma emission following acute and repetitive exposure to hypoxia.Followingrepeat exposure to hypoxia for one or two runs, the contents of non-soluble in brainhomogenats as was notably decreased,while that of the soluble V was markedly increased,when compared with that of normal group.When the animals were fed for two daysafter four runs of hypoxia,the contents of As,Fe,Cu,Co,Cr,B,and V were all signi-ficantly or very significantly changed in comparison with the normal value.Further stu-dies are needed to find out the biological importance of these changes and the relationshipbetween them and hypoxia tolerance.
